Applications
The compound (1alpha,2alpha,5alpha)-6,6-Dimethylbicyclo(3.1.1)heptane-2-carbaldehyde (CAS number: 49751-88-4) is commonly used as a chiral intermediate and auxiliary in asymmetric organic synthesis, serving as a building block for pharmaceutical and agrochemical derivatives; it can function as a fragrance intermediate or odorant component in perfumery and cosmetics; it is also employed as a precursor in specialty chemicals and polymer-related applications; researchers often explore its role as a source of chiral ligands or catalytic auxiliaries in enantioselective reactions.
